Why Norway Is a Strong Market for Swedish Candy

Norway and Sweden share a deeply rooted candy culture, including a strong tradition of fredagsgodt — the Norwegian equivalent of Sweden's lördagsgodis pick & mix tradition. Norwegian consumers are familiar with and actively seek Swedish candy formats, giving suppliers with genuine Swedish provenance a natural market advantage.

Norway consistently ranks among Europe's highest GDP-per-capita countries. Norwegian consumers spend more on confectionery per head than most European markets, and retail buyers are willing to source premium imported candy at competitive wholesale prices.

Norway's position outside the EU means Norwegian importers operate active supply chain relationships with European candy suppliers. Wholesale buyers are experienced international purchasers, comfortable with cross-border logistics, and actively seeking reliable European supply partners.

Candy Formats for the Norwegian Market

Candora Trading supplies the candy formats best suited to Norwegian retail: Swedish jelly candy, sour candy, pick & mix assortments (loose and pre-packed), licorice formats (particularly relevant in the Norwegian market), vegan candy, and seasonal confectionery for Christmas — Norway's peak candy season.

Pricing, MOQ and Container Programmes

Pricing at Candora Trading is designed to offer competitive advantages while ensuring quality and sustainability. Container programs start from palletised quantities, allowing flexibility for pilot programs that test market demand.

For standard orders, we typically use 20ft or 40ft FCL containers, providing efficient delivery in bulk. Minimum order quantities (MOQ) are structured to cater to various buyer needs, starting with palletised quantities for initial tests and expanding as your business grows.

Our direct relationships with European factories ensure optimal pricing without the overhead of middlemen, making Candora Trading a cost-effective partner for Norwegian buyers. Lead times average 4-8 weeks from order confirmation, ensuring timely delivery without compromising on quality or freshness.
